Izicelo:
I-nickel yensimbi ene-spongy, i-iron, ithusi kanye nemizimba yabo enezingqimba eyinhlanganisela ye-porous ingasetshenziswa njengabathwali bokuhlunga, abathwali bamakhemikhali amakhemikhali, izinto zokuvikela ugesi, ukushintshwa kwensimbi eyigugu kanye nokululama kanye neminye imikhakha eminingi.
1. Izinto ze-electrode zebhethri
Igwebu le-nickel lisetshenziselwa ikakhulukazi izinto ze-electrode yebhethri, ikakhulukazi amabhethri e-NiMH, asetshenziswa kakhulu kumakhompyutha aphathekayo, omakhalekhukhwini, izikuta zikagesi, amabhayisikili kagesi, nezimoto eziyingxubevange.
2. Fuel cell
Izinga lokushisa elisebenzayo lamaseli e-carbonate fuel cell ngokuvamile liphakathi kuka-550-700 °C, futhi igwebu le-nickel lingasetshenziswa njenge-electrocatalyst yamaseli e-carbonate fuel cell. Igwebu le-nickel lingasetshenziswa njengento yokuguqulwa kwepuleti eliguquguqukayo lamaseli okukhiqiza ulwelwesi lwe-proton exchange (PEMFC), iziphakeli ze-electrode relay zamaseli e-solid oxide fuel cell (SOFC), nezinto ze-electrode ku-electrolysis (njengasezindaweni ze-electrolyte yamanzi). Indawo engaphezulu ekhulisiwe ingase futhi isetshenziselwe ukukhiqiza i-hydrogen nama-syngas kumaseli kaphethiloli.
3. Izinto ze-Catalyst
Isakhiwo esiyingqayizivele samaseli avulekile, izimbobo zokufakwayo ezinomfutho ophansi, amandla emvelo aqinile kanye nokumelana nokushaqeka okushisayo kwenza igwebu le-nickel libe ikhambi elinamandla lokuthwala iziguquli ze-catalyst yezimoto, ukusha kwe-catalytic, kanye nezihlanzi intuthu emnyama yemoto kadizili. Lapho injini iqala ukubanda, i-carbon monoxide nama-hydrocarbon aguqulwa. Ngenxa yezakhiwo zokuqhuba ukushisa, isithwali se-nickel catalyst esinegwebu singase sibe ngaphezu kwesithwali se-ceramic catalyst. Ngalo mqondo, igwebu le-nickel lingafaniswa nesithwali sensimbi esikwazi ukumelana nokushisa okuphezulu. Izisekelo ze-Steel catalyst ziphakeme kakhulu. Ezinye izinhlelo zokusebenza ze-nickel foam catalysts zingabandakanya ukusabela kwe-Fischer-Topsch, ukuguqulwa kwegesi, i-hydrogenation yamakhemikhali amahle, nezisekelo ze-foam catalyst.
4. Ezinye izinhlelo zokusebenza
Igwebu le-nickel lingasetshenziswa njengesihlungi, isikhombi sokugeleza kazibuthe esiphatha izinhlayiya kazibuthe oketshezini. Ezinye izinhlelo zokusebenza zihlanganisa izinhlelo zokusebenza kwimidiya yokugcina i-hydrogen, imidiya yokushintshanisa ukushisa.

I-nickel foam iyinto ebamba umsindo esebenza kahle kakhulu, ene-coefficient ephezulu yokumunca umsindo kumafrikhwensi aphezulu; ukusebenza kokumuncwa komsindo kumaza aphansi kungathuthukiswa ngomklamo wesakhiwo esimunca umsindo. Igwebu le-nickel futhi lingenye yezinto ezihamba phambili ze-electrode ekwenzeni amabhethri e-cadmium-nickel namabhethri e-hydrogen-nickel.
